Tuscany offers a variety of liquids: We enjoyed thermal water, wine and olive oil. Now we’re heading back to the sea. We have chosen Porto Ercole in the south of Tuscany as our next destination. To be precise: The Argentario Golf Resort & Spa, an eco-friendly resort located in a verdant valley and a member of the Design Hotels family.

Off the golf course there is a lot to see and to discover. In the rooms we are impressed by beautiful design pieces and wonderful views. The panoramic terrace invites you to let the gaze wander: Over the huge golf course, the lush green forest and the sprouting trees. Let your spirits calm just for a bit.

The expanded lobby elicits us an awestruck “Wooow!”. The bright white, imposing staircase magically attracts every guest. Spacious rooms, peppered with architecture and design details, wide windows with a view … Where should we even start? Maybe on the golf course? Or rather with breakfast? One can enjoy the rich buffet all chilled out on very comfy designer armchairs. We could do this all morning. Cakes, fruits, cereals and organic yoghurt are so exquisitely prepared. The chef cooks egg dishes of all kinds directly in the show kitchen, also used for cooking classes. Either there or in the gourmet hotel restaurant Dama Dama everything is homemade from local and organic ingredients. No matter how the weather is outside, we start our day with joy and energy. 🙂

The hotel is centrally located and offers a variety of popular destinations in the area. Some of them will certainly be mentioned in a separate blog post. For once, here’s a selection:

  • Il Giardino dei Tarocchi by Niki de Saint Phalle
  • The sensual town of Capalbio
  • World-famous village of Pittigliano or the little sister Sorano
  • Hot springs of Saturnia (our tip: Cascate del Mulino)
  • Castiglione della Pescaia
  • Porto Ercole and Orbetello

In the hotel itself we’re discovering the large spa area. The Espace Wellness Center offers a bio-sauna, a beauty center, a large swimming pool (indoor and outdoor), a very large modern gym and further amenities. The hotel also offers pool tables, tennis courts and jogging tracks. We can join yoga, horse-riding, cooking classes, wine tastings and, most importantly, we can play golf. Yay! The Argentario Golf Club features 18 panoramic holes and is awarded with the “BioAgriCert” certification for its eco-compatibility.

The spacious hotel room also features a private terrace and other amenities. From the bed you can even operate the automatic night curtain. In warm summer nights the electric fly screens are a guarantee to wake up without stitches.

In Porto Ercole we discover a small but lively spot: The Bar Baraka, run by Matteo. He recommends exploring his hometown from the highest point of the Argentario Peninsula. The view is supposed to be breathtaking. Unfortunately, the next day storm clouds are so low that we cannot even see the mountain itself. So, we’re off inland to the Saturnia hot springs. After a heavy thunderstorm breaking right over the Etruscan town of Pittigliano we recover in hot water. What an experience!
